St. Louis Cardinals Roster Moves 3/23

St. Louis Cardinals Roster Transactions | Inside The Diamonds

The Cardinals played the Houston Astros Thursday and lost 9-1 in Grapefruit League action. They played today Saturday 3/23 against the Washington Nationals at 1:05 PM after this game they will have three spring games remaining before they start the regular season. They open the season on the road when they go and face the Los Angeles Dodgers on Thursday, March 28th. Before today’s spring training game, they have announced several moves to clean up the roster ahead of their first regular season game.

1B – Alfonso Rivas III

Rivas III was optioned this morning to Triple AAA Memphis Redbirds. This spring he played in 22 games, with six runs scored, three doubles, three RBIs, five walks, and slashed .194/.356/.278 with a .634 OPS this spring. Last season he played 48 big league games eight with the San Diego Padres and 40 with the Pittsburgh Pirates. Over the 48 games last year he slashed .229/.303/.422 with a .725 OPS combined.

RHP – Nick Robertson

Robertson was optioned this morning to the Memphis Redbirds the Triple AAA team for the Cardinals. This spring he appeared in eight games, throwing eight innings, striking out nine, with a 4.50 ERA and a 1.75 WHIP. Last year Robertson played 18 games nine apiece between the Dodgers and the Boston Red Sox. He started one game last year for the Red Sox. He pitched 22.1 innings with a 0-1 record, 26 strikeouts, nine walks, a 6.04 ERA, and a 1.75 WHIP combined between both teams.

1B – Luken Baker

Baker was also optioned to the Memphis Redbirds this morning ahead of today’s game. In the spring Baker had 44 at-bats, scored two runs, one home run, six RBIs, and slashed .205/.250/.295 with a .545 OPS. Last season with the Cardinals he played in 33 games with, nine runs scored, three doubles, two home runs, 10 RBIs, 13 walks, and slashed .209/.313/.314 with a .627 OPS.

2B – Jared Young

Young will be heading to Triple AAA Memphis today as he was optioned ahead of the game this morning. Young this spring has played in 22 games with two runs scored, one double, one RBI, 11 strikeouts, one steal, and slashed .081/.244/.108 with a.352 OPS. Last year he played in 16 games for the Division rival Chicago Cubsc, he had three triples, two home runs, eight RBIs, three walks, two steals, and slashed .186/.255/.465 with a .720 OPS.
